Responsibilities

  • Conducting proactive threat hunts across endpoint, network, cloud, and log data to identify malicious activity, anomalous behavior, and indicators of compromise
  • Analyzing security telemetry, alerts, and artifacts to investigate threats and support detection, containment, and remediation activities
  • Developing hunt hypotheses based on threat intelligence, adversary tactics, techniques, and procedures, and documented attack patterns
  • Partnering with security operations, incident response, and engineering teams to improve detections, close visibility gaps, and strengthen defensive capabilities
  • Documenting hunt methodologies, findings, and recommendations, and communicating results to technical stakeholders and team leadership

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, Cybersecurity, Information Technology, Engineering, or a degree in a related technical field
  • 3+ years of experience in threat hunting, security operations, detection engineering, or incident response
  • 3+ years of experience with security information and event management platforms, endpoint detection and response platforms, and network analysis tools
  • 2+ years of experience doing the following:
    • Analyzing endpoint, network, cloud, and log telemetry to identify suspicious or malicious activity
    • Mapping adversary behavior to MITRE ATT&CK and documenting hunt findings and recommendations
  • Ability to travel 20%, on average, based on the work you do and the clients and industries/sectors you serve
  • Active Secret clearance or higher
  • One or more certifications such as Certified Information Systems Security Professional, GIAC Certified Incident Handler, or GIAC Certified Forensic Analyst
  • Must be legally authorized to work in the United States without the need for employer sponsorship, now or at any time in the future

Preferred:

  • 1+ years of experience supporting government or public sector cybersecurity environments
  • 2+ years of experience creating or tuning detection logic, analytic rules, or hunt queries
  • 2+ years of experience with the following:
    • Digital forensics or malware analysis
    • Cloud security monitoring in Amazon Web Services or Microsoft Azure environments
    • Using Python, PowerShell, or Structured Query Language for analysis or automation
